WHY SHOULD THE VOTING AGE BE LOWERED?


Just a small introduction; Hello, I'm a student from the UK and I wanted to challenge a part of society that I didn't believe was right. I wanted to challenge the voting age because I believe that the government is not applying their selves to young people and what they think about society. Young people don't have a voice when it comes to politics and therefore they cannot do much to change society to make it a better place.


In the United Kingdom, those who are under the age of 18 are not eligible to vote. I believe, along with many other young adults that the voting age should be decreased to include those who are 16 years of age. Secondary schools are providing students with a sufficient amount of citizenship education, so the government cannot say that we are too young to think about who is best suited to run our country. Also, 16 year olds can legally have sex at that age, but are they still irresponsible enough to vote? 16 year olds can make responsible decisions and they should have a say on who gets to look after their own country. With only those who are aged 18 and above being able to vote, younger adults do not have a voice and they cannot express their political opinions and most importantly, votes in elections won't be representative of every person, which is what democracy is really about. Overall, 16 year olds should have a vote so they can express their political opinions!
